About This Property

This semi-detached flat is located in FARNBOROUGH, GU14 9AE. The property offers 71mยฒ (764 sq ft) of modest-sized living space with 3 habitable rooms. It is a post-war property from the mid-20th century. With an EPC rating of D (67/100), this property is around the UK average for energy efficiency. With recommended improvements, it could achieve a C rating (78/100). The gas central heating system has good efficiency, indicating a relatively modern, well-maintained boiler. The property has modern timber frame or system-built walls, which typically offer good insulation properties when properly maintained. Double glazing is installed, though the efficiency rating suggests older units. Modern low-E double glazing can be up to 40% more efficient than units installed before 2002. Estimated annual energy costs are ยฃ1045, comprising ยฃ808 for heating, ยฃ176 for hot water, and ยฃ61 for lighting. The property produces 2.8 tonnes of CO2 per year, which is low for a UK home. What do these speeds mean? 10-30 Mbps: Good for browsing and streaming. 30-100 Mbps: Great for multiple users and HD streaming. 100-300 Mbps: Excellent for 4K streaming and gaming. 300+ Mbps: Perfect for large households and heavy internet use.
